The mirrors that you buy at any store are bottom reflective. Top reflective optics mirrors as used in a laser are specialized items with few manufacturers.

Depending on the lens focal length you need as much as 2" more than the height of the part to fit it into the maximum space with the laser floor dropped all the way down. If the z stroke is 8", and...
That dimension should be listed in the specs for any machine you are considering. My Epilog will hold items 8" tall. Look for the Z-Stroke, or on many Chinese machines "Up and Down work Plate". The...

On mine the manufacturer advertised 11,000 hours. My first tube died at just 500 hours while on warranty, the second lasted about 2,000 before dying a couple of months after the warranty expired....
